How much can solar panels save you in Luton?

A typical 4kW solar panel system in Luton generates around 4,200 kWh per year, saving you approximately £643 annually on electricity bills and export payments. With 1,600 hours of sunshine per year, most Luton homeowners see payback within 10–13 years.

A typical 4kW solar system in Luton can save you around £643 per year on electricity bills, with a payback period that makes it a strong long-term financial investment. Combined with the Smart Export Guarantee and 0% VAT, the financial case for solar in Luton is compelling.

Luton receives around 1,600 hours of sunshine per year, making it a solid location for solar panel installations. The town has a diverse housing stock ranging from inter-war semis in areas like Stopsley and Limbury to newer developments in the Marsh Farm and Bramingham estates. Many Luton homeowners are choosing solar to reduce rising energy costs, and the town's position in the South East means panels perform well throughout the year.

Solar panel output and savings by system size in Luton

Generation and savings below are modelled for Luton's location, using a regional solar yield of 1050 kWh/kWp on a south-facing roof with no shading.

The installed cost column is a national figure, not a Luton price. It is the DESNZ median of £1,780.25 per kW for systems up to 4 kW, derived from the MCS Installation Database and covering England, Scotland and Wales. No official dataset publishes installed costs at city level, and we will not imply one exists. Half of real installations cost more than the median.

Luton generation modelled at 1050 kWh/kWp regional yield. Cost is the NATIONAL DESNZ 2025/26 median, not a Luton price. Electricity 26.11p/kWh, export 4.5p/kWh. 0% VAT.
System SizePanelsCostAnnual SavingPayback
3 kW~8 panels£5,340£482~11 years
4 kW~10 panels£7,120£643~11 years
5 kW~13 panels£8,480£804~11 years

Solar energy in Luton: local context

The South East benefits from some of the highest solar irradiance in the UK. Homes across the region — from coastal towns to commuter belt suburbs — see above-average solar generation, making the financial case particularly strong.

Luton homeowners benefit from 0% VAT on residential solar installations (until at least March 2027) and can earn income through the Smart Export Guarantee by selling surplus electricity back to the grid.
